Best career paths after B.Ed to explore 

Here are some of the best career paths given below. Have a look at them one by one. 

1. School Teacher

Becoming a school teacher is one of the most popular professions following B.Ed course. It provides you with the opportunity to influence young minds and develop interesting lessons, and leave a great impact on the future of students. The teaching is also a source of stability and respect in society.

2. Private Tutor

In case you like individual studying, the best career option after a B.Ed degree is private tutoring. It is flexible, has increased earning capacity, choice of subjects and timing, and helps students succeed in their academic work.

3. Educational Consultant

Numerous schools and institutes seek professional advice concerning curriculum development and strategies in teaching. This is one of the most ideal careers to follow after B.Ed as an educational consultant who helps establishments on how to enhance teaching practices.

4. Online Educator

Online teaching platforms are offering dream employment opportunities upon B. Ed course with digital learning is taking off. Students all over the world can be taught, lectures can be recorded, and digital courses can be designed, making the education process more accessible and innovative.

5. School Principal/Administrator

Once you have experience, you are able to enter school administration. You can be a principal or coordinator who can organise academic performance, control teachers, and provide a favourable environment in the learning process. It involves a big responsibility in a leadership role.

6. Education Researcher

In case you are interested in experimenting with new methods of teaching, this is a great way to be an education researcher. You can also play a role in policy making, publish articles, and come up with innovations in the education sector.

7. Corporate Trainer

Trainers are usually required to develop the skills of employees. A B.Ed background also provides you with skills in teaching and presentations, and therefore would make you fit in the field of training in a corporate setting.

8. Special Education Teacher

Special education is a developing area where professional teachers assist children with learning disabilities. This is a very fulfilling job because you offer personalized instructions that transform the lives of the students.

9. Curriculum Developer

Schools and universities require professionals to create curriculum material in the form of textbooks, learning materials, and tests. Your B.Ed knowledge will ensure that your learning materials are effective and interesting to the students.

10. Government Teaching Jobs

A large number of graduates take part in the government exams in order to occupy the teaching slots in the public schools and colleges. Such are the most sought-after career choices upon obtaining a B.Ed degree since they are job-secure, provide benefits, and stability in the long term.
